    Chauffeur Driven Car in Chandigarh: Where It Fits Your Trip

    A chauffeur driven car in Chandigarh covers a range of trips, each with its own character:

    • Airport and station transfers. Chandigarh Airport (IXC) and Chandigarh Railway Station both handle a steady mix of business travellers and tourists heading onward into Himachal Pradesh.
    • City sightseeing. The Rock Garden, Sukhna Lake, and the Capitol Complex sit within a compact loop, and this is usually a half-day rather than a full one.
    • Shimla. At just under three and a half hours, this is Chandigarh’s most-booked hill route by a wide margin — close enough for many visitors to treat as a long day trip, though an overnight gives more room to actually enjoy it.
    • Manali. A genuinely longer haul at seven-plus hours, this is booked almost exclusively as a multi-day trip rather than anything shorter.
    • Amritsar. The Golden Temple draws a steady flow of same-day and overnight visitors, roughly three and a half hours from Chandigarh on a well-maintained highway.
    • Tricity corporate movement. Mohali’s IT and business parks and Panchkula both generate their own transport needs, distinct from Chandigarh proper but served on the same terms.

    Best Places to Visit in Chandigarh by Chauffeured Car

    Chandigarh’s own sights sit close together and make for a comfortable half-day; the Capitol Complex specifically requires advance permission to enter.

    PlaceDrive from Sector 17Suggested TimeNote
    Rock Garden15 min1.5–2 hrNek Chand’s sculpture garden built from industrial and household waste
    Sukhna Lake15 min1–1.5 hrA boating lake with a lakeside promenade, best in the evening
    Rose Garden (Zakir Hussain Rose Garden)10 min45 min–1 hrOne of Asia’s larger rose gardens; peak bloom is February–March
    Capitol Complex10 min1–1.5 hrLe Corbusier’s Vidhan Sabha, High Court, and Secretariat, and a UNESCO World Heritage Site; entry requires advance ID-based permission arranged by the visitor, not something the chauffeur can process
    Sector 17 PlazaCentral1–1.5 hrThe city’s central shopping and leisure plaza
    Government Museum and Art GalleryCentral1 hrA useful midday stop, particularly if the weather doesn’t favour the gardens

    A full city day — Rock Garden in the morning, Sukhna Lake and the Rose Garden after lunch, Sector 17 Plaza in the evening — fits comfortably inside the 8-hour local package.

    Best Restaurants in Chandigarh Your Chauffeur Can Route Through

    Chandigarh’s food scene runs strongly Punjabi, and the city has a handful of genuinely well-known names worth seeking out specifically. Pal Dhaba, split across Sector 28 and Sector 41, has built its reputation on classic dhaba-style Punjabi food over decades. Sindhi Sweets is a long-running favourite for chaat and traditional sweets across several sectors. Backpackers Café and Virgin Courtyard, both in Sector 26’s dedicated food-and-nightlife stretch, offer a more contemporary, casual dining option. Elante Mall’s food court covers a straightforward multi-cuisine spread if the plan is to combine a meal with shopping.

    Sector 26’s evening crowd makes parking tight in that stretch specifically, so a drop-and-call arrangement often works better than a car waiting curbside there.

    Best Shopping Places in Chandigarh to Cover by Car

    Chandigarh’s Sector-planned layout extends to its shopping too — Sector 17 Plaza is the city’s organised central hub, Sector 22’s market offers a more everyday retail experience nearby, and Elante Mall covers large-format mall shopping with straightforward parking. Compared with the older, denser markets typical of most Indian cities, Chandigarh’s shopping districts are genuinely easier to navigate by car, a direct result of the city’s planned design.

    A half-day loop through Sector 17, Sector 22, and Elante Mall covers the city’s main shopping options comfortably.
